What the Code Actually Gives You
Pull up the “golden mister casino bonus code 2026 no deposit required” and you’ll see a few free spins tossed at you like a dentist’s lollipop. Nothing more. The maths underneath is as cold as a London winter. You get, say, 20 free spins on a slot that pays 96.5% RTP. That’s a 3.5% house edge humming in your ear while you chase a tumble of glitter. And because they love to dress it up, the casino will slap “VIP” in quotes on the offer, as if they’re handing out charity.
And then there’s the wagering. Twenty times the bonus amount. You’ll need to burn through a thousand pounds of bets before you can even think about cashing out a handful of winnings. The whole thing feels like a cheap motel promising “fresh paint” while the plumbing still leaks.
- Free spins: 20‑30, usually on a low‑variance slot.
- Wagering requirement: 20‑30x the bonus value.
- Maximum cash‑out: often capped at £10‑£20.
- Expiry: 48‑72 hours, give or take.
But it isn’t just the numbers that are laughable. The terms hide clauses that make you feel like you’ve signed a contract with a shark. One line reads “Only winnings derived from free spins are eligible for withdrawal.” If you win on a regular bet, you’re back to square one.

Why the No‑Deposit Myth Persists
Because marketers love the word “free.” Nobody reads the entire terms page, so they plaster “no deposit required” in big letters. The reality is the casino isn’t giving you money; it’s giving you a chance to place a wager that benefits them regardless of the outcome. The more you play, the more data they collect, the better they can target you with future promos.
And the psychological trick works. You feel entitled after a handful of free spins, even if the wins are tiny. The brain’s reward system lights up, and the next thing you know you’re topping up your account with your own cash, chasing the phantom of a big win. It’s the same principle that makes a free spin feel like a free lollipop at the dentist – a sweet treat that costs you far more in the long run.
